The Fireflite is a Sedan with a spacious interior, fitting up to 6 passengers in its 4 doors. It has a length of 5535 mm (217.91 in) and a width of 1989 mm (78.31 in), providing ample legroom and shoulder room. The height of the vehicle is 1539 mm (60.59 in) and it has a wheelbase of 3200 mm (125.98 in), ensuring a smooth and stable ride. The front and rear tracks are 1529 mm (60.2 in) and 1514 mm (59.61 in) respectively, providing excellent handling and stability. The Fireflite has a minimum turning circle of 13.4 m (43.96 ft), making it easy to maneuver in tight spaces. The approach, departure, and ramp over angles are 21°, 12°, and 11° respectively, allowing the vehicle to handle various terrains. The ground clearance of the Fireflite is 160 mm (6.3 in), providing adequate protection against obstacles on the road.

Engine & Transmission
The car in question is a Fireflite with an internal combustion engine, producing 200 HP at 4400 rpm and 371 Nm of torque at 2800 rpm. The engine displacement is 4769 cm3, a V-engine with 8 cylinders and a carburettor. The car has a 3-speed manual transmission, rear-wheel drive, and a rear leaf spring suspension. The car's cooling system has a capacity of 22.7 liters and the engine oil capacity is 4.7 liters.

Brakes
The Fireflite is a classic car with a worm-reduction unit steering system and hydraulic power steering, ensuring a smooth driving experience. The car features drum brakes on both the front and rear wheels, with a diameter of 305 mm.

Weight & Capacity
The Fireflite has a weight-to-power ratio of 8.8 kg/Hp (113.4 Hp/tonne) and a weight-to-torque ratio of 4.8 kg/Nm (210.3 Nm/tonne), with a kerb weight of 1764 kg (3888.95 lbs.) and a fuel tank capacity of 76 l (20.08 US gal | 16.72 UK gal).
